In a certain machine at a fun fair, a man stands against the wall of a circular room of radius 3 m. The room rotates about a vertical axis through the centre of the floor at 2 rad/sec., then the floor is lowered- If the man does not slip vertically downwards, the least value of the coefficient of friction between the man and wall is
When the machine rotates. the man also
rotates with the wall. The contact force R between the wall and man is centripetal force. Due to this contact force R, there is frictional force µ R. The upward frictional force is balanced by weight of the man. Hence
